I'm using vB as a backend for my site. We use it for many things, one of which is posting news. Often times my news posters will want to make a thread and then add a reply with additional information immediately after posting. The way vB handles this is to merge the first post with any replys that are posted after by the same user.
This is a bit hard to understand so I'll use an example. I post some information about a band's upcoming tour. I make a reply (the first reply to that thread) with the list of tour dates and vB just adds the reply to the original post. I want it to instead leave the original post as is no matter who replies to it. If there's a setting for this, please point me in the right direction as I must have missed it while sifting through all the options. I wasn't able to find a hack that did this either. |
